What are the spec differences between the "ZTE Zmax 2 (2015) 16GB" and "BLU Dash L (2015) 4GB" ?
A summary of the technical specifications of the "ZTE Zmax 2 (2015) 16GB" and "BLU Dash L (2015) 4GB". Functions and performance variations on the same model will be highlighted in red.
ZTE Zmax 2 (2015) 16GB | BLU Dash L (2015) 4GB | |
Color | Black | Black/White/Teal/Pink/Gold/Green |
OS | Android | Android |
Dimensions (width x height x thickness) | 76.0mm x 153.9mm x 9.4mm | 64.0mm x 126.0mm x 11.0mm |
Weight | 170.1g | 122.0g |
Display size | 5.5inch | 4.0inch |
Display type | IPS LCD | TFT |
Screen resolution (width x height) | 720 x 1280 | 480 x 800 |
Pixel density | 267ppi | 233ppi |
Battery capacity | 3000.0mAh | 1450.0mAh |
Chipset | Qualcomm MSM8916 Snapdragon 410 | Mediatek MT6572 |
CPU specs | 1.2GHz×4(4.0-cores) | 1.0GHz×2(2.0-cores) |
RAM size | 2.0GB | 512.0MB |
Storage size | 16.0GB | 4.0GB |
Rear-camera resolution | 8.0MP | 15.0MP |
Front-camera resolution | 2.0MP | |
